If you want a lower look go with the eibach sport springs, they are not too low. if you want to go low low, kgmm street for comfort. For coilovers the H&R's are reasonably priced and comfortable. The Tein CS and RA's are comfortable too, but a little more $$.

I had TEINS RA and now I am running BuddyClub racing spec, both are very good coilovers but with BuddyClub i can slam my car a bit more and it has more adjustments. If your in the market for some coilovers, I'd say go for BuddyClub racing spec or JIC magic.
